  5. Nov 3, 2024Complaint investigation
    4 findings · critical
    • CriticalTexas: High

      AP Background check results - Must receive notification prior to allowing subject to be present at your operation

      Based on the evidence obtained during the investigation, an individual was allowed to be present at the operation without an eligible background check.

      Corrected Nov 27, 2024, verified Dec 1, 2024. Technical assistance given. Standard 745.641.

    • CriticalTexas: High

      Personal use of electronic devices, cell phones, MP3 players, and video games. Cell phones briefly used and supervision is maintained

      Based on the evidence obtained during the investigation, a caregiver was using their cell phone for personal tasks not associated with caring for the children.

      Corrected Nov 27, 2024, verified Dec 9, 2024. Technical assistance given. Standard 747.1501(c)(4)(C).

    • SeriousTexas: Medium High

      AP Report Child Injury Requiring Medical Treatment by a Health-Care Professional or Hospitalization

      Based on the evidence obtained during the investigation, a child was injured while in care and had to seek medical treatment. The operation failed to notify Child Care Regulation within the two-day timeframe of this occurring.

      Corrected Nov 27, 2024, verified Dec 9, 2024. Technical assistance given. Standard 747.303(a)(2).

    • SeriousTexas: Medium

      Incident/Illness Report Form Shared with Parent

      Based on the evidence obtained during the investigation, the operation failed to provide a parent with an incident report after their child had been injured.

      Corrected Nov 27, 2024, verified Dec 9, 2024. Technical assistance given. Standard 747.707.
